hydrogen peroxide alkaline bleaching stabilizer

Use: Stabilizer for Hydrogen peroxide bleaching with sodium chlorite.
Appearance: Yellow transparent liquid.
Ionicity: Anion
pH Value: 9.5 (10g/l solution)
Water solubility: Completely soluble
Hard water stability: Very stable at 40°DH
Acid-Base Stability to pH: Very stable at 20Bè
Chelating Ability: 1g Stabilizing agent 01 can chelate mgr. Fe3+
190 at pH 10
450 at pH 12
Foaming Characteristics:
Foaming property: NO
Storage stability:
Store at room temperature for 9 months. Avoid long time storage near 0℃ and high temperature environment.

Characteristics:
1. Stabilizing agent 01 is a stabilizer specifically used for alkaline bleaching of cotton in the pad-steam process. Due to its strong stability in alkaline media, it is beneficial for the oxidant to continuously play a role in long-term steaming. And easily biodegradable.
2. Stabilizing agent 01 can partially or completely replace the use of silicate, so that the bleached fabric has better hydrophilicity, while avoiding the formation of deposits on the equipment due to the use of silicate.
3. The best bleaching formula varies with different processes, and it is recommended to test in advance
4. Even in stock-solution with high content of caustic soda and surfactant, Stabilizing Agent 01 is stable, so it can prepare mother liquid containing various chemicals with a concentration of 4-6 times higher.
5. Stabilizing agent 01 is also very suitable for pad-batch processes.

Usage and Dosage
Pad-Steam
Stabilizing agent 01 can be directly added to the feeding bath before adding hydrogen peroxide.
Padding (wet on wet)
5-8 ml/l Stabilizing agent 01
50ml / l 130vol. Hydrogen peroxide
30ml / l 360Bè caustic soda
3-4 ml/l Scouring agent
Pick-Up: 10-25%, depending on different fabrics
Steam for 6-12 minutes to make the hydrogen peroxide work
Continuous water washing

Pad-Batch (on dry fabric)
8 ml/l Stabilizing agent 01
50ml/l 130vol. Hydrogen peroxide
35ml/l 360Bè caustic soda
8-15ml/l 480Bè sodium silicate
4-6 ml/l Scouring agent
2-5 ml/l Chelating agent
Cold-batch process for 12-16 hours
Washings with hot water on continuous line
